Conditional displacement operator for traveling fields

Abstract

We show that the conditional displacement operator U^CD=exp[b^b^(βa^βa^)]\hat{U}_{CD}=\exp [\hat{b}^{\dagger}\hat{b}(\beta \hat{a}^{\dagger}-\beta ^{\ast}\hat{a})] acting upon an arbitrary state of traveling waves can be well approximated by the action of a Kerr medium placed between two beam splitters whose respective second ports are fed by highly excited coherent states. Applications to the generation of nonclassical states and measurement of Wigner function of arbitrary states are also considered.
